Description
This wonderfully stylish family home has been remodelled and extended to create an exceptional open plan kitchen / dining / reception room, on the lower floor, measuring an impressive 426 x 152 which leads on to the West facing rear garden with side pedestrian access and home office. On the upper floors is the principal bedroom suite and family bathroom and two further double bedrooms.
Richford Street runs South off Goldhawk Road linking to Hammersmith Grove and is therefore well located for access to the broad variety of local facilities. Transport links include the underground stations at Goldhawk Road (Hamm & City and Circle lines), Shepherds Bush (Central and overland lines), Hammersmith (Piccadilly, District, Hamm & City and Circle lines), numerous local bus routes and access to both A40 and A4. Shopping and leisure facilities can be found at Westfield London, Hammersmith Broadway, the BBC development as well as local shopping along Goldhawk Road and King Street. The house is also in the catchment for St Stephens Primary school one of the top schools in the country.
